Handover: Exportron retry queue

Hi Mira — handing over the failed-export retries. Exports that hit a timeout land in the retry queue and get three attempts with backoff; after that they're parked and need a manual requeue from the admin panel. Watch for customers reporting duplicates — that usually means a double requeue. The current retry settings are as follows.

settings of bajog-fawig:
oliael:
  log_level: warn
  metrics_host: metrics.oliael.zemvarsys.internal
  pin: 0267
  pool_size: 32

# Environments — Cobblewick Component Library

Cobblewick ships as a shared library pinned per environment. Staging tracks the latest minor; production pins an exact patch. On-call: never bump production during an incident — mismatched component versions break the theming contract and render blank panels. Version pins live in the deploy manifest, not package files, so a hotfix requires a manifest change plus redeploy. To verify what an environment is actually running, compare against the values below.

deployment values, yadug-bawif:
[framir]
team = pelox
access_code = ac_a38ab2
owner = tamion.julael
host = framir.tolvaqlabs.test
port = 11211
peer = tammir.zemvargrid.local
salt = 2215ef03
pin = 1541

## Step 3: Pin the Component Library Version

As of Brindlewick UI v4, shared components no longer float on the latest minor release. Each consuming app must pin an exact version in its manifest before upgrading. Skipping this step causes mismatched theme tokens at build time. Update your manifest to match the values below, then rerun the bundler.

deployment values, tahaf-fajog:
[ralmir]
host = ralmir.paliqcorp.internal
user = ralmir_svc
database = ralmir_prod

Ticket: Missed Pick-up — Gallery Labels

The scheduled collection of the printed wall labels for the new Tidemark Gallery did not occur Tuesday. The carton (42 mounted labels, plus spares) is still at the Fenwood print shop loading bay. Prenner Couriers confirmed the driver logged the stop as closed in error. A replacement pick-up is booked for Thursday morning. Records team: please hold the catalogue reconciliation until the labels arrive and are checked against the object list. The courier hand-over must follow the instruction below.

dispatch memo: the silok lamdor courier leaves the pramir tamix julax ledger at gate 7050 under passcode 555680